Understanding the Value of Advanced Stunt Zones in Trampoline Parks

MARWEY advanced trampoline park stunt zones featuring high-performance equipment and acrobatic performers in a vibrant, futuristic indoor arena.

Stunt zones are designed specifically for skilled jumpers and performers. Unlike general jump areas, stunt zones incorporate specialized equipment like angled trampolines, foam pits, and vaulting apparatuses that allow for advanced aerial tricks. These zones make your park more attractive to enthusiasts and professionals, encouraging longer visits and premium pricing. As observed in my work on high-impact trampoline parks, facilities implementing stunt zones saw visitor engagement increase by over 30%, while average spend per visitor grew by 15% within the first year.

From a financial standpoint, investing approximately 20–25% more into stunt zone equipment compared to standard setups can result in a 40% higher revenue per square meter, attributed to the appeal to advanced jumpers and special event opportunities. Moreover, stunt zones can create distinct programming options such as parties, competitions, and workshops that further diversify revenue streams.

A critical component is adherence to industry-recognized safety standards. In the United States, ASTM International’s voluntary standard ASTM F2970 guides trampoline park operations. Compliance with such standards is essential in stunt zones, where risks are higher due to complex maneuvers. Operators adopting these norms benefit from lower insurance premiums and reduced liability risks.


Key Equipment Features for Stunt Zones: Performance Meets Safety

MARWEY dynamic trampoline park scene showcasing stunt zones with cutting-edge safety standards and energetic jumpers mid-air.

High-quality trampoline park stunt zones require equipment engineered for both elite performance and stringent safety. MARWEY’s products emphasize:

  • Durable, reinforced trampolines with variable tension zones to support advanced tricks.
  • Deep foam pits with certified impact-absorbing materials to cushion dangerous landings.
  • Modular vaulting and obstacle features facilitating diverse stunt routines and progressive skill development.
  • Integrated safety nets and padding conforming to European safety standards EN 1176 and EN 1177, ensuring global compliance.

My experience delivering turnkey solutions for global trampoline parks confirms that premium materials and compliance with TÜV and ASTM certifications, while increasing upfront costs by 10–15%, directly contribute to a 25% reduction in injury-related downtime annually. This operational reliability not only safeguards guests but also protects revenue flow by minimizing insurance claims and promoting positive brand reputation.

Frequently Asked Questions about Trampoline Park Stunt Zones and Equipment

Q1: What makes stunt zones different from regular trampoline areas?
Stunt zones feature specialized equipment like angled trampolines and foam pits designed for advanced tricks, supporting higher skill levels and giving visitors unique experiences that standard zones cannot offer.

Q2: How do safety standards affect trampoline park insurance costs?
Adhering to ASTM and TÜV certifications can reduce insurance premiums by up to 20% by demonstrating commitment to safety and lowering the risk of accidents.

Q3: How significant is the initial investment difference for stunt zone equipment?
Stunt zones typically require 20-25% higher upfront costs due to enhanced materials and safety features but yield higher revenues and faster ROI.

Q4: Can stunt zones attract a more profitable customer segment?
Yes, stunt zones are especially popular among advanced jumpers and performers who often spend more on premium experiences and repeat visits.

Q5: How do stunt zones contribute to diversified income streams?
They enable hosting competitions, lessons, and events, adding revenue channels beyond day-to-day admissions.

Q6: What role does equipment certification play in operational uptime?
Certified equipment reduces injury-related downtime, ensuring smoother operations and consistent guest flow.

Q7: How can operators model the ROI of installing stunt zones?
Partners like MARWEY provide detailed financial models based on project-specific data, including cost, expected revenue uplift, and payback periods.

Q8: What maintenance challenges do stunt zones present?
High-usage stunt zones require regular inspection and foam pit maintenance but benefit from durable, reinforced equipment to minimize repair frequency.

Q9: Are there specific global standards MARWEY’s equipment complies with?
Yes, MARWEY’s equipment adheres to ASTM International standards in the US and TÜV certifications relevant in Europe and other markets.

Q10: How quickly can a trampoline park recover the investment in stunt zones?
With optimized operations and marketing, typical payback periods range from 12 to 18 months, shorter than standard trampoline setups.
